JUSTICE SUDHIR SINGH ORAL ORDER 27-07-2015 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Additional Public Prosecutor for the State. The petitioner apprehends arrest in a case registered for the offences punishable under sections 341, 323, 353, 307/34 of the Indian Penal Code.

The informant has alleged that he stopped one person from urinating at the main gate of Kunwar Singh Hata. He asked the persons working at Pandal of Durga Puja to see that no body urinates near the campus. It is alleged that the informant was assaulted and when his friend Uday Pratap Singh arrived there he was also assaulted.

On behalf of the petitioner it is submitted that the petitioner has no criminal antecedent. The petitioner has been

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.29227 of 2015 (2) dt.27-07-2015 named in the present case due to mistake of facts. Being member of the Committee he was managing Puja Pandal. No specific injury or overt act has been alleged against the petitioner. On behalf of the State, it is submitted that the petitioner is named in the F.I.R.

Considering the facts aforesaid, let the petitioner above named, in the event of arrest or surrender in the court below within four weeks from the date of receipt/production of a copy of this order, be enlarged on anticipatory b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s.10,000/- (Ten th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ned Chief Judicial Magistrate, Bhojpur at Arrah in connection with Jagdishpur P.S. Case no., 285 of 2014, subject to the conditions as laid down under section 438(2) of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973. (Sudhir Singh, J) Amin/- U
